What Is Patient Monitor Parameter Verification Service (Spo2/nibp/ecg/temp) In Kenya?

Patient Monitor Parameter Verification Service (SpO2/NIBP/ECG/Temp) in Kenya refers to the systematic process of confirming the accuracy and reliability of critical physiological parameter measurements obtained from medical patient monitoring devices. This service ensures that the SpO2 (peripheral oxygen saturation), NIBP (non-invasive blood pressure), ECG (electrocardiogram), and Temperature readings generated by these monitors are within acceptable clinical tolerances and comply with relevant regulatory standards. The objective is to guarantee the integrity of diagnostic and therapeutic data, thereby supporting informed clinical decision-making and patient safety.

Key Components of Patient Monitor Parameter Verification Service:

  • Calibration: Adjusting the monitor's internal settings to align its output with known, traceable standards for each parameter (e.g., using calibrated simulators for SpO2, NIBP, and ECG; certified thermometers for temperature).
  • Performance Testing: Evaluating the monitor's response to simulated physiological signals and challenging conditions to assess its accuracy, precision, linearity, and range across its operational specifications.
  • Functional Checks: Verifying the proper operation of all associated components, including sensors, transducers, cabling, and display interfaces.
  • Documentation: Maintaining comprehensive records of all verification activities, including calibration certificates, test results, methodologies used, and technician qualifications.
  • Traceability: Ensuring that all calibration standards and reference instruments used are traceable to national or international metrology institutes.
  • Preventive Maintenance Integration: Often performed concurrently with or as part of scheduled preventive maintenance to identify and rectify potential issues before they impact performance.

Who Needs Patient Monitor Parameter Verification Service (Spo2/nibp/ecg/temp) In Kenya?

Patient Monitor Parameter Verification Service (SpO2/NIBP/ECG/Temp) is crucial for ensuring the accuracy and reliability of vital sign measurements in healthcare settings across Kenya. This service is essential for any facility that utilizes patient monitoring equipment to make informed clinical decisions, manage patient care effectively, and maintain patient safety. Without regular verification, devices can drift out of calibration, leading to potentially life-threatening misdiagnoses or delayed interventions.

Patient Monitor Parameter Verification Service (Spo2/nibp/ecg/temp) Cost In Kenya

The cost of patient monitor parameter verification services (SpO2, NIBP, ECG, and Temperature) in Kenya can vary significantly based on several factors. These services are crucial for ensuring the accuracy and reliability of medical equipment, which directly impacts patient care. The pricing is influenced by the scope of the verification, the type and age of the monitor, the service provider's expertise and accreditation, and the location within Kenya. A comprehensive verification of multiple parameters on a single device will generally be more expensive than verifying just one parameter. Similarly, older or more complex monitors may require more specialized tools and expertise, leading to higher costs. Reputable service providers with proper certifications and a strong track record will often command higher prices but offer greater assurance of quality.

ParameterEstimated Cost Range (KES)Notes
SpO2 (Pulse Oximetry) Verification3,000 - 7,000Includes functional check and accuracy verification.
NIBP (Non-Invasive Blood Pressure) Verification3,500 - 8,000Covers cuff inflation/deflation accuracy and pressure readings.
ECG (Electrocardiogram) Verification4,000 - 9,000Tests lead integrity, signal quality, and waveform accuracy.
Temperature Verification2,500 - 6,000Ensures accuracy of temperature probes and readings.
Multi-Parameter Verification (Package)10,000 - 25,000+For monitors with 3 or more parameters, often offered at a discounted package rate. This is a broad range depending on the specific parameters and monitor.
Annual Service ContractNegotiable (Varies greatly)Discounts for regular scheduled maintenance and verification of multiple devices.

Key Factors Influencing Patient Monitor Parameter Verification Costs in Kenya:

  • Number of Parameters Verified: Verifying SpO2, NIBP, ECG, and Temperature individually versus as a package.
  • Type and Complexity of Patient Monitor: Basic single-parameter monitors vs. advanced multi-parameter systems.
  • Age and Condition of the Monitor: Older or malfunctioning devices may require more extensive testing and calibration.
  • Service Provider's Reputation and Accreditation: Certified technicians and accredited facilities may charge more.
  • Location of Service: On-site service at a hospital or clinic versus bringing the equipment to a service center.
  • Urgency of Service: Rush or emergency services often incur additional fees.
  • Included Calibration and Certification: Whether a formal certificate of calibration is provided.
  • Travel and Logistics Costs: For on-site services, especially in remote areas.

Scope Of Work For Patient Monitor Parameter Verification Service (Spo2/nibp/ecg/temp)

This Scope of Work (SOW) outlines the services to be provided for the verification of patient monitor parameters, specifically SpO2, NIBP, ECG, and Temperature. The service aims to ensure the accuracy, reliability, and compliance of these critical monitoring functions with established standards. This document details the technical deliverables, standard specifications, and the overall process for conducting the verification.

ParameterVerification ProcedureStandard Specification / ToleranceTechnical Deliverables
SpO2 (Oxygen Saturation)Simulated blood oxygen saturation measurements using a calibrated simulator. Verification at multiple saturation levels (e.g., 70-100%).± 2% (at saturation levels above 70%) as per ISO 80601-2-61, IEC 60601-1.SpO2 accuracy verification report. Traceability of simulator calibration.
NIBP (Non-Invasive Blood Pressure)Automated cuff inflation and deflation cycles. Comparison with a calibrated reference manometer or validated NIBP simulator. Verification at multiple pressure points (systolic, diastolic, mean).Systolic: ± 5 mmHg. Diastolic: ± 5 mmHg. Mean: ± 7 mmHg as per ISO 81060-2, IEC 60601-1.NIBP accuracy verification report. Traceability of reference manometer/simulator calibration.
ECG (Electrocardiogram)Simulated ECG waveforms (e.g., normal sinus rhythm, arrhythmias) using a calibrated ECG simulator. Verification of lead detection, heart rate display, and signal integrity.Heart Rate: ± 5 bpm or ± 5% (whichever is greater). Amplitude and waveform characteristics as per IEC 60601-2-27, IEC 60601-1.ECG accuracy verification report. Traceability of simulator calibration.
TemperatureVerification of temperature probe functionality and accuracy using a calibrated temperature bath or a calibrated temperature source. Measurement at a minimum of three distinct temperature points within the monitor's operational range.± 0.1°C or ± 0.2°C (depending on the temperature measurement technology and probe type) as per relevant ISO standards (e.g., ISO 80601-2-56), IEC 60601-1.Temperature accuracy verification report. Traceability of temperature bath/source calibration.
GeneralVisual inspection for damage, cleanliness, and presence of essential accessories. Verification of alarm functionality for each parameter (high/low limits). Verification of power and battery operation.All alarms to function within specified parameters. Visual inspection to identify any defects that might impair safe operation.Comprehensive Patient Monitor Verification Report including: cover page with client and service provider details, date of service, list of verified monitors, summary of results for each parameter, any deviations noted, recommendations (if any), and technician signatures.
